Four-Year-Old Case Howard Raises Lots of Money for St. Jude
A few weeks ago, I shared a story about four-year-old Case Howard. He and his mother, Heather Howard, were listening to the WBKR St. Jude Radiothon when it aired the first two days of February. Case, after hearing some of our St. Jude stories on the Radiothon, started asking questions that indicated he understood a lot of what he was hearing. He asked, "Mama, St. Jude's a hospital? Those kids are sick?" Heather started answering and Case started asking even more questions. Those questions then led to a powerful, bold statement. Case finally proclaimed, "I give them money too." And, since that time, this preschooler has been raising money in all kinds of ways! In fact, you won't believe how much money he's raised!
This week, Case and his family are headed to Memphis. They decided to plan their Spring Break trip around a visit to St. Jude Children's Research Hospital. Case's mom, Heather, is going to be taking a tour. And though he's too young to visit the hospital, Case will be on the St. Jude campus to make his donation to the patients of St. Jude. And what a donation it is!
By establishing an internet donation page, selling eggs from his family's chickens, gathering sponsors and hosting a huge yard sale, Case has raised over $2900!! His goal was just $300. As you can see, he shattered it!
Heather says the family are excited about their trip to St. Jude. In her words, "I have a feeling it's going to change my life forever." True statement. And this one is true as well. The donation that Case makes Tuesday morning in Memphis is going to change lives too.
Welcome to the St. Jude family, Case!
